WebThe nurse's cap was derived from the nun's habit and developed over time into two types: A long cap, that covers much of the nurse's hair, and A short cap, that sits atop the nurse's hair (common in North America and the United Kingdom). The nursing cap was originally used by Florence Nightingale in the 1800s. Karen Albright, California ... WebAug 25, 2024 · Wearing your hair down as a nurse can be a safety issue. In mental health facilities especially, nurses are cautioned to wear their hair up so the patients don’t pull on it or grab it. In dealing with other unstable, angry, violent, or confused patients, having your hair down can make it easy for it them to harm you.
